1 Èmi yóò kọrin fún ẹni tí mo fẹ́ràn orin kan nípa ọgbà àjàrà rẹ̀. Olùfẹ́ mi ní ọgbà àjàrà kan ní ẹ̀gbẹ́ òkè ẹlẹ́tù lójú.
Let me sing for my well beloved a song of my beloved about his vineyard. My beloved had a vineyard on a very fruitful hill.
2 Ó tu ilẹ̀ rẹ̀, ó ṣa òkúta ibẹ̀ kúrò ó sì gbin àyànfẹ́ àjàrà sí i. Ó kọ́ ilé ìṣọ́ sí inú rẹ̀ ó sì ṣe ìfúntí kan síbẹ̀ pẹ̀lú. Lẹ́yìn náà, ó ń retí èso àjàrà dáradára, ṣùgbọ́n èso búburú ni ó ti ibẹ̀ wá.
He dug it up, gathered out its stones, planted it with the choicest vine, built a tower in its midst, and also cut out a winepress in it. He looked for it to yield grapes, but it yielded wild grapes.
3 “Ní ìsinsin yìí ẹ̀yin olùgbé Jerusalẹmu àti ẹ̀yin ènìyàn Juda ẹ ṣe ìdájọ́ láàrín èmi àti ọgbà àjàrà mi.
"Now, inhabitants of Jerusalem and men of Judah, please judge between me and my vineyard.
4 Kín ni ó kù tí n ò bá túnṣe sí ọgbà àjàrà mi. Ju èyí tí mo ti ṣe lọ? Nígbà tí mo ń wá èso dáradára, èéṣe tí ó fi so kíkan?
What could have been done more to my vineyard, that I have not done in it? Why, when I looked for it to yield grapes, did it yield wild grapes?
5 Ní ìsinsin yìí, èmi yóò wí fún ọ ohun tí n ó ṣe sí ọgbà àjàrà mi. Èmi yóò gé igi inú rẹ̀ kúrò, a ó sì pa á run, Èmi yóò wó ògiri rẹ̀ lulẹ̀ yóò sì di ìtẹ̀mọ́lẹ̀.
Now I will tell you what I will do to my vineyard. I will take away its hedge, and it will be eaten up. I will break down its wall of it, and it will be trampled down.
6 Èmi yóò sì sọ ọ́ di ahoro láì kọ ọ́ láì ro ó, ẹ̀wọ̀n àti ẹ̀gún ni yóò hù níbẹ̀. Èmi yóò sì pàṣẹ fún kurukuru láti má ṣe rọ̀jò sórí i rẹ̀.”
I will lay it a wasteland. It won't be pruned nor hoed, but it will grow briers and thorns. I will also command the clouds that they rain no rain on it."
7 Ọgbà àjàrà Olúwa àwọn ọmọ-ogun ni ilé Israẹli àwọn ọkùnrin Juda sì ni àyànfẹ́ ọgbà rẹ̀. Ó retí ìdájọ́ ẹ̀tọ́ ṣùgbọ́n, ìtàjẹ̀ sílẹ̀ ni ó rí. Òun ń retí òdodo ṣùgbọ́n ó gbọ́ ẹkún ìpayínkeke.
For the vineyard of the LORD of hosts is the house of Israel, and the men of Judah his pleasant plant: and he looked for justice, but, look, oppression; for righteousness, but, look, a cry of distress.
8 Ègbé ni fún àwọn tí ń kọ́lé mọ́lé tí ó sì ń ra ilẹ̀ mọ́lẹ̀ tó bẹ́ẹ̀ tí ààyè kò ṣẹ́kù tí ó sì nìkan gbé lórí ilẹ̀.
Woe to those who join house to house, who lay field to field, until there is no room, and you are made to dwell alone in the midst of the land.
9 Olúwa àwọn ọmọ-ogun ti sọ ọ́ sí mi létí: “Ó dájú pé àwọn ilé ńlá ńlá yóò di ahoro, àwọn ilé dáradára yóò wà láìní olùgbé.
In my ears, the LORD of hosts says: "Surely many houses will be desolate, even great and beautiful, unoccupied.
10 Ọgbà àjàrà sáré oko mẹ́wàá yóò mú ìkòkò wáìnì kan wá, nígbà tí òsùwọ̀n homeri kan yóò mú agbọ̀n irúgbìn kan wá.”
For ten acres of vineyard shall yield one bath, and a homer of seed shall yield an ephah."
11 Ègbé ni fún àwọn tí wọ́n dìde ní kùtùkùtù òwúrọ̀ láti lépa ọtí líle, tí wọ́n sì mu ún títí alẹ́ fi lẹ́ títí wọ́n fi gbinájẹ pẹ̀lú wáìnì.
Woe to those who rise up early in the morning, that they may follow strong drink; who stay late into the night, until wine inflames them.
12 Wọ́n ní dùùrù àti ohun èlò orin olókùn níbi àsè wọn, ṣaworo òun fèrè àti wáìnì, ṣùgbọ́n wọn kò ka iṣẹ́ Olúwa sí, wọn kò sí bọ̀wọ̀ fún iṣẹ́ ọwọ́ rẹ̀.
The harp, lyre, tambourine, and flute, with wine, are at their feasts; but they do not regard the work of the LORD, neither have they considered the operation of his hands.
13 Nítorí náà àwọn ènìyàn mi yóò lọ sí ìgbèkùn nítorí òye kò sí fún wọn, ebi ni yóò pa àwọn ọlọ́lá wọn kú; ẹgbàágbèje wọn ni òǹgbẹ yóò sì gbẹ.
Therefore my people go into captivity for lack of knowledge. Their honorable men are famished, and their multitudes are parched with thirst.
14 Nítorí náà isà òkú ti ń dátọ́mì gidigidi, ó sì ti ya ẹnu rẹ̀ sílẹ̀ gbagada, nínú rẹ̀ ni àwọn gbajúmọ̀ àti mẹ̀kúnnù yóò sọ̀kalẹ̀ sí pẹ̀lú ọlá àti ògo wọn. (Sheol h7585)
Therefore Sheol has enlarged its desire, and opened its mouth without measure; and their glory, their multitude, their pomp, and he who rejoices among them, descend into it. (Sheol h7585)
15 Báyìí, ènìyàn yóò di ìrẹ̀sílẹ̀ àti ọmọ ènìyàn ni a sọ di onírẹ̀lẹ̀ ojú agbéraga ni a sì rẹ̀ sílẹ̀.
So man is brought low, humankind is humbled, and the eyes of the arrogant ones are humbled;
16 Ṣùgbọ́n Olúwa àwọn ọmọ-ogun ni a ó gbéga nípa ẹ̀tọ́ rẹ̀, Ọlọ́run ẹni mímọ́ yóò sì fi ara rẹ̀ hàn ní mímọ́ nípa òdodo rẹ̀.
but the LORD of hosts is exalted in justice, and God the Holy One is sanctified in righteousness.
17 Nígbà náà ni àwọn àgùntàn yóò máa jẹ́ ko ní ibùgbé e wọn, àwọn ọ̀dọ́-àgùntàn yóò máa jẹ nínú ahoro àwọn ọlọ́rọ̀.
Then the lambs will graze as in their pasture, and kids will eat the ruins of the rich.
18 Ègbé ni fún àwọn tí ń fi ohun asán fa ẹ̀ṣẹ̀, àti àwọn tí o dàbí ẹni pé wọ́n ń fi okùn kẹ̀kẹ́ ẹ̀sìn fa ẹsẹ̀,
Woe to those who draw iniquity with cords of falsehood, and wickedness as with cart rope;
19 sí àwọn tí ó sọ pé, “Jẹ́ kí Ọlọ́run ṣe kíákíá, jẹ́ kí ó yára ṣiṣẹ́ rẹ̀ kí a lè rí i, jẹ́ kí ó súnmọ́ bí jẹ́ kí ètò ẹni mímọ́ Israẹli kí ó dé, kí àwa kí ó le mọ̀ ọ́n.”
Who say, "Let him make speed, let him hasten his work, that we may see it; and let the counsel of the Holy One of Israel draw near and come, that we may know it."
20 Ègbé ni fún àwọn tí ń pe ibi ní rere, àti rere ní ibi, tí ń fi òkùnkùn ṣe ìmọ́lẹ̀ àti ìmọ́lẹ̀ ṣe òkùnkùn, tí ń fi ìkorò ṣe adùn àti adùn ṣe ìkorò.
Woe to those who call evil good, and good evil; who put darkness for light, and light for darkness; who put bitter for sweet, and sweet for bitter.
21 Ègbé ni fún àwọn tí ó gbọ́n lójú ara wọn tí wọ́n jáfáfá lójú ara wọn.
Woe to those who are wise in their own eyes, and prudent in their own sight.
22 Ègbé ni fún àwọn akọni nínú wáìnì mímu àti àwọn akíkanjú nínú àdàlú ọtí,
Woe to those who are mighty to drink wine, and champions at mixing strong drink;
23 tí wọ́n dá ẹlẹ́bi sílẹ̀ nítorí àbẹ̀tẹ́lẹ̀, tí wọn sì du aláre ní ẹ̀tọ́.
who acquit the guilty for a bribe, but deny justice for the innocent.
24 Nítorí náà, gẹ́gẹ́ bí ahọ́n iná ṣe ń jó àgékù koríko run àti bí koríko ṣe rẹlẹ̀ wẹ̀sì nínú iná, bẹ́ẹ̀ ni egbò wọn yóò jẹrà tí òdodo wọn yóò sì fẹ́ lọ bí eruku: nítorí pé wọ́n ti kọ òfin Olúwa àwọn ọmọ-ogun sílẹ̀ wọ́n sì gan ọ̀rọ̀ Ẹni mímọ́ Israẹli.
Therefore as the tongue of fire devours the stubble, and as the dry grass sinks down in the flame, so their root shall be as rottenness, and their blossom shall go up as dust; because they have rejected the law of the LORD of hosts, and despised the word of the Holy One of Israel.
25 Nítorí náà, ìbínú Olúwa gbóná si àwọn ènìyàn rẹ̀, ó ti gbé ọwọ́ rẹ̀ sókè, ó sì lù wọ́n bolẹ̀. Àwọn òkè sì wárìrì, òkú wọn sì dàbí ààtàn ní àárín ìgboro. Pẹ̀lú gbogbo èyí, ìbínú rẹ̀ kò yí kúrò, ṣùgbọ́n ọ̀wọ́ rẹ̀ sì ná jáde síbẹ̀.
Therefore the LORD's anger burns against his people, and he has stretched out his hand against them, and has struck them. The mountains tremble, and their dead bodies are as refuse in the midst of the streets. For all this, his anger is not turned away, but his hand is still stretched out.
26 Yóò sì gbé ọ̀págun sókè sí àwọn orílẹ̀-èdè tí ó jìnnà, yóò sì kọ sí wọn tí ó wà ní ìpẹ̀kun ilẹ̀. Sì kíyèsi, wọ́n yóò yára wá kánkán.
He will lift up a banner to the nations from far, and he will whistle for them from the far regions of the earth. Look, they will come speedily and swiftly.
27 Kò sí ẹni tí yóò rẹ̀ nínú wọn, tàbí tí yóò kọsẹ̀, kò sí ẹni tí yóò tòògbé tàbí tí yóò sùn; bẹ́ẹ̀ ni àmùrè ẹ̀gbẹ́ wọn kì yóò tú, bẹ́ẹ̀ ni okùn sálúbàtà wọn kì yóò ja.
None shall be weary nor stumble among them; none shall slumber nor sleep; neither shall the belt of their waist be untied, nor the latchet of their shoes be broken:
28 Àwọn ọfà wọn múná, gbogbo ọrun wọn sì le; pátákò àwọn ẹṣin wọn le bí òkúta akọ, àwọn àgbá kẹ̀kẹ́ wọn sì dàbí ìjì líle.
whose arrows are sharp, and all their bows bent. Their horses' hoofs will be like flint, and their wheels like a whirlwind.
29 Bíbú wọn dàbí tí kìnnìún, wọ́n bú bí ẹgbọrọ kìnnìún, wọ́n ń kọ bí wọ́n ti di ẹran ọdẹ wọn mú tí wọn sì gbé e lọ láìsí ẹni tí yóò gbà á là.
Their roaring will be like a lioness. They will roar like young lions. Yes, they shall roar, and seize their prey and carry it off, and there will be no one to deliver.
30 Ní ọjọ́ náà, wọn yóò hó lé e lórí gẹ́gẹ́ bí i rírú omi Òkun. Bí ènìyàn bá sì wo ilẹ̀, yóò rí òkùnkùn àti ìbànújẹ́; pẹ̀lúpẹ̀lú ìmọ́lẹ̀ yóò di òkùnkùn pẹ̀lú kurukuru rẹ̀.
They will roar against them in that day like the roaring of the sea. If one looks to the land look, darkness and distress. The light is darkened in its clouds.
